Расчет ручной скидки &НаСервере

//добавим скидку на товары
Если НЕ СуммаСкидки = 0 Тогда
			
Ограничения = Новый ТаблицаЗначений;
Ограничения.Колонки.Добавить("ЦеноваяГруппа");
Ограничения.Колонки.Добавить("СуммаБезСкидки");
Ограничения.Колонки.Добавить("СуммаРучнойСкидки");
Ограничения.Колонки.Добавить("СуммаАвтоматическойСкидки");
Ограничения.Колонки.Добавить("МаксимальныйПроцентРучнойСкидки");
Ограничения.Колонки.Добавить("МаксимальныйПроцентРучнойНаценки");
Ограничения.Колонки.Добавить("МаксимальнаяСуммаРучнойСкидки");
Ограничения.Колонки.Добавить("МаксимальнаяСуммаРучнойНаценки");
			
СтрОграничения 									= Ограничения.Добавить();
СтрОграничения.ЦеноваяГруппа 					= Справочники.ЦеновыеГруппы.ПустаяСсылка();
СтрОграничения.СуммаБезСкидки                   = ЗаказКлиентаОбъект.Товары.Итог("Сумма");
СтрОграничения.СуммаРучнойСкидки                = 0;
СтрОграничения.СуммаАвтоматическойСкидки        = 0;
СтрОграничения.МаксимальныйПроцентРучнойСкидки  = 999.99;
СтрОграничения.МаксимальныйПроцентРучнойНаценки	= 999.99;
СтрОграничения.МаксимальнаяСуммаРучнойСкидки	= (ЗаказКлиентаОбъект.Товары.Итог("Сумма")*999.99)/100;
СтрОграничения.МаксимальнаяСуммаРучнойНаценки   = (ЗаказКлиентаОбъект.Товары.Итог("Сумма")*999.99)/100;

ТЗ_Товары = ЗаказКлиентаОбъект.Товары.Выгрузить(); 
ТЗ_Товары.Колонки.Добавить("ЦеноваяГруппа");

АдресВремХранилища = ПоместитьВоВременноеХранилище(Новый Структура("Ограничения, Товары, ИспользоватьОграниченияРучныхСкидок", Ограничения, ТЗ_Товары, Ложь), Новый УникальныйИдентификатор());

СкидкиНаценкиСервер.НазначитьРучнуюСкидку(ЗаказКлиентаОбъект,"Товары", СуммаСкидки,Ложь,Ложь,Ложь,Ложь,Неопределено,АдресВремХранилища,Ложь);	

КонецЕсли;
Орфографическая ошибка в Неопределено: Неопределено
OneTracker - трекер учета рабочего времени программиста 1С

Похожие публикации

ВыполнитьРегламентноеЗаданиеВручную (БСП)

ЭтоРегистрРасчета (БСП)

ЭтоПланВидовРасчета (БСП)

Создание и инициализация менеджера расчета зарплаты

ТаблицаДанныхДляРасчетаРассмотрено (БСП)

Модератору